Discover Ludwig"can known" is not a correct or commonly used phrase in written English.
Instead, the correct phrase would be "can be known." This phrase is typically used to indicate that something has the potential to be or become known by someone. Example: The true identity of the mysterious figure could be known if more evidence is uncovered.
